概括
膜蒸 (MD) 对海水淡化有希望,但面临着生物污染的挑战. 本综述研究了温度如何影响微生物生长和生物膜形成,这对于理解和减轻MD生物污染至关重要.

背景情况:
- 膜蒸 (MD) 提供了具有废热回收潜力的低温淡化.
- 生物污染仍然是一个重大挑战,阻碍了MD技术的广泛应用.
- 微生物活动,包括生长和生物膜形成,对温度敏感,影响MD的性能.

主要成果:
- 温度显著影响微生物生长率,浮游生物生存范围以及随后的生物膜形成.
- 高温可以改变生物膜的组成和特性,可能会加剧污染.
- 在膜蒸装置内将热效应与生物污染联系起来的具体数据是有限的.
结论:
- 了解温度依赖的微生物和生物膜动态对于解决MD生物污染至关重要.
- 需要进一步的研究,以充分阐明膜蒸系统中的生物污染机制.
- 鉴定藻类,生物膜和细胞外聚合物质 (EPS) 的特征将有助于预测和管理生物污染.

Cell membranes are composed of phospholipids, proteins, and carbohydrates loosely attached to one another through chemical interactions. Molecules are generally able to move about in the plane of the membrane, giving the membrane its flexible nature called fluidity. Two other features of the membrane contribute to membrane fluidity: the chemical structure of the phospholipids and the presence of cholesterol in the membrane.

Green algae, also referred to as chlorophytes, are different from red algae in having the chloroplasts containing chlorophylls a and b, which give them their distinct green hue. However, they lack phycobiliproteins, preventing them from developing the red or blue-green pigmentation seen in red algae. Every organism has an optimum temperature range within which healthy growth and physiological functioning can occur. At the ends of this range, there will be a minimum and maximum temperature that interrupt biological processes.
